Sitemdeki içeriği/tasarımı araklıyorlar, ne yapmak lazım (makale)

nokie

Müptela Üye
Katılım
23 Mar 2005
Mesajlar
1,597
Beğeniler
8
Yaş
35
Konum
İzmir
#1
Web sitesi olan her arkadaşın başına gelmiştir muhakkak, zaman içerisinde tecrübe edinip, mümkün olan en az şekilde bu durumdan etkilenmek istemişizdir. Bazılarımız; nasılsa çalıyorlar kardeşim, yapacak birşey yok diyip bırakanlarımızda olmuştur.

Biz bu makalede bu durumdan nasıl en az şekilde etkileniriz onu işleyeceğiz, şunu söylemekte fayda var; %100 olarak bu durumu çözmenin yolu yoktur, anlatacaklarımız sadece bu girişimi yapanların, amacına ulaşmasını zorlaştıracaktır.

1. SAYFALARDA DIV VE CSS KULLANMAK

Sayfalarınızda ağırlıklı olarak div ve css kullanın, bu durum; kopyala yapıştır yöntemiyle tasarımınızı çalmak isteyenlerin işini oldukça zorlaştıracaktır, örnek:

menüler için:

HTML:
<div class="menu">
menü içeriği
</div>
içerik için:

HTML:
<div id="sayfa_icerigi">
içerik v.b.
</div>
2. CSS DOSYANIZIN ÇALINMASINI ÖNLEYİN

Aşağıdaki kodu .htaccess dosyanıza ekleyerek, doğrudan web üzerineden erişilip çalınmasını önleyebilirsiniz:

Kod:
RewriteEngine on
RewriteCond %{HTTP_REFERER} !^http(s)?://(www\.)?alanadı.com [NC]
RewriteRule \.css$ - [NC,F,L]
alanadı.com yazan yere kendi site adresinizi yazıyorsunuz.

Alternatif olarak html guardian kullanarak, css içeriğini şifreleyebilir ve bu şekilde kullanabilirsiniz, html guardian hakkında daha fazla bilgi için: http://www.htmlguardian.org/help_main.html

3. FOTOĞRAFLARDA WATERMARK KULLANIN

Sayfalarınızda kullandığınız resimlerde watermark kullanarak site adınızın yada isminizin bir şekilde geçmesini sağlayın. Yatay olarak boydan boya resim üzerine yapılan watermarklar oldukça etkilidir, resmi araklamak isteyenin bu durum işine gelmeyecek ve resmi almaktan vazgeçecektir.

Örnek watermark yazılımı:
http://www.batchphoto.com/features/watermark-photos.html

Örnek watermarklanmış bir resim:
http://www.batchphoto.com/images/screenshots/s2-filter-watermarkt.jpg

4. SAYFALARDAKİ İÇERİKTE BELİRLİ NOKTALARA LİNK KOYMAK

Sayfadaki belirli noktalara link koyarsanız, sitenizin içeriği çalınsa bile, içeriğinizi araklayan kişi sitenize bedavadan link vermiş olacaktır, içeriğin çalındığı için üzülebilir ama sitenizin pagerank'ına katkıda bulunacağını için sevinebilirsiniz.

Örnek:

İyinet webmaster kaynakları.

Bu örnekte kaynakları yazan kısımdaki y harfine sitemizin linkini verdik, ayrıyetten satırın sonundaki nokta işaretinede link verdik. Benzerleri virgüllere uygulanabilir.

5. SAYFALARDAKİ İÇERİĞE HTML AÇIKLAMALARI EKLEYİN

Sayfa içeriğinizi hazırlarken belirli noktalara html içeriği ekleyin, böylece kaynak göster yöntemiyle içeriğinizi çalmak isteyenlerin işine çomak sokmuş olursunuz.

Örnek vermek gerekirse, html kaynağında yazılarımız şu şekilde gözükecektir:

HTML:
<!-- iyinet.com webmaster kaynakları -->
[B]İyinet Seo Yarışmasına Katılım Kuralları[/B]
<!-- / iyinet.com webmaster kaynakları -->
Yarışmaya katılım ücretsizdir.
<!-- iyinet.com webmaster kaynakları -->
Yarışmaya sponsor olan sitelere nofollow kullanılmadan link verme zorunluğuğu vardır.
<!-- / iyinet.com webmaster kaynakları -->
Ziyaretçilerimizin okuduğu sayfalarda ise şu şekilde gözükecektir:

İyinet Seo Yarışmasına Katılım Kuralları
Yarışmaya katılım ücretsizdir.
Yarışmaya sponsor olan sitelere nofollow kullanılmadan link verme zorunluğuğu vardır.
Bu şekildeki html açıklamaları, kaynak göster seçeneğiyle çalınacak içerikte etkili olacaktır, araklayıcı bu html açıklamalarını tek tek temizlemek zorunda kalacaktır. Html açıklamaları sadece kaynak göster seçeneğinde görülebileceğinden, normal sayfa içeriğinde gözükmeyecektir.

6. SAYFALARINIZDAKİ YAZILARIN MAUSE İLE SEÇİLEBİLMESİNİ ENGELLEYİN

Sayfanızdaki içeriğin kopyalanmasının bir kolay yoluda içeriği mause ile taratıp sağ tuş tıklayıp "kopya" sonra yayınlanacak yerde "yapıştır" tıklanarak yapılabilmektedir. Basit bir java script ile yazıların mause ile taranabilmesi engellenebilmektedir, bunun için aşağıdaki kodu
HTML:
</body></html>
arasında bir yere eklemeniz yeterli:

Kod:
<script type="text/javascript">

function disableSelection(target){
if (typeof target.onselectstart!="undefined")
	target.onselectstart=function(){return false}
else if (typeof target.style.MozUserSelect!="undefined")
	target.style.MozUserSelect="none"
else
	target.onmousedown=function(){return false}
target.style.cursor = "default"
}

disableSelection(document.body)

</script>
Bu kod şuan IE6 ve Firefox 1.5 sürümü ve üstü tüm versiyonlarda çalışmaktadır.

7. SAYFALARINIZDA MAUSE SAĞ TUŞ KULLANMA ÖZELLİĞİNİ KAPATIN

Sayfalarınızda mause sağ tuş özelliğini pasifleştirerek, gerek resimlerinizi, gerek site içeriğinizi koruyabilirsiniz, 5. adımda ki sitede içeriğin mause ile taranabilmenisini önledikten sonra bu özelliğinde kullanılması, sayfalarda doğrudan ctrl+c yada sağ tuş kopyala yöntemiyle içeriğin çalınması engellenmektedir.

Aşağıdaki javascript kodu ile sayfalarınızda
HTML:
</body></html>
kodları arasına yerleştirip, mause sağ tuş kullanımını pasifleştirebilirsiniz:

Kod:
<script language=JavaScript>
<!--
var message="";
function clickIE() {if (document.all) {(message);return false;}}
function clickNS(e) {if 
(document.layers||(document.getElementById&&!document.all)) {
if (e.which==2||e.which==3) {(message);return false;}}}
if (document.layers) 
{document.captureEvents(Event.MOUSEDOWN);document.onmousedown=clickNS;}
else{document.onmouseup=clickNS;document.oncontextmenu=clickIE;}

document.oncontextmenu=new Function("return false")
// --> 
</script>
Bu kod şuan IE6 ve Firefox 1.5 sürümü ve üstü tüm versiyonlarda çalışmaktadır.

8. TÜM BU ANLATILANLARI YAPTIM, BU SEFERDE SCREEN SHOT ALIP İÇERİĞİ ÇALIYORLAR

Sayfanızdaki yazıların arka planına sabit bir yazı yazarsanız örnek www.iyinet.com şekilde yatay ve çaplazlama şeklinde, bunada önlem alabilirsiniz.

Bunun için CSS dosyanıza aşağıdaki satırı ekleyin:

Kod:
.rastgele {
 background-image: url(/dizin/rastgele.gif);
 background-position: top left;
 background-color: #FFFFFF;
 margin-right: auto;
 margin-left: auto;
}
Html dosyanızda kullanacağınız kodlar:

HTML:
<div class="rastgele" style="width: 800px">
</div>
Böylece sitedeki yazılarınızın arka planında rastgele.gif içindeki içerik gösterilecektir.

9. SİTE İÇERİĞİNİZİ ARŞİVCİLER VE SİTE KOPYALIYICI ROBOTLARDAN KORUYUN

Bunun EKTE yollamış olduğum robots.txt dosyasını bilgisayarınıza kaydettikten sonra, adını robots.txt olarak değiştirip, web sitenizin ana dizinine ftp aracılığı ile yollayın, eğer bir robots.txt dosyanız varsa sitenizde, ekteki robots.txt dosyasındaki içeriği, ekstradan mevcut robots.txt dosyanızın içine ekleyebilirsiniz. Böylece zararlı robotların site içeriğinizi kopyalamalarının önüne geçebilirsiniz.

10. BÜTÜN BUNLARI YAPMADAN ÖNCE RESİMLERİMİ ARAKLAMIŞLAR NASIL ENGELLERİM

Hotlink koruması ile daha önceden sitenizden çalınmış fotoğrafları ve bundan sonra çalınmak istenenleri engelleyebilirsiniz, bunun için aşağıdaki kodu .htaccess dosyanızın içine ekleyin, .htaccess dosyanız yoksa yeni bir tane oluşturun ve ftp ile site ana dizininize atın:

Kod:
RewriteEngine On
RewriteCond %{HTTP_REFERER} !^http://(.+\.)?alanadı\.com/ [NC]
RewriteCond %{HTTP_REFERER} !^$
RewriteRule .*\.(jpe?g|gif|bmp|png)$ /resimler/engelle.jpe [L]
böylece daha önceden resimlerinizin çalındığı sitede, artık o resimler yerine sizin /resimler/engelle.jpeg resminde belirlemiş olduğunuz içerik gösterilecektir.

Benden bukadar arkadaşlar, tüm bu anlattıklarım tecrübeyle sabittir, sizinde tecrübeleriniz varsa bu başlık altından devam edebilirsiniz.

Emeğe saygı için bu yazıyı yayınlayacağınız yerde bu başlığın linkini vermeyi unutmayın, duyarlı arkadaşlara sonsuz teşekkürler.
 

uggur

Profesyonel Üye
Katılım
3 Şub 2008
Mesajlar
153
Beğeniler
3
Konum
İzmir
#4
Yazı için teşekkürler arşivime atıyorum. Bir keresinde kendi tasarımımı olduğu gibi klonlamışlardı deli olmuştum. :(
 

nokie

Müptela Üye
Katılım
23 Mar 2005
Mesajlar
1,597
Beğeniler
8
Yaş
35
Konum
İzmir
#5
Yazı için teşekkürler arşivime atıyorum. Bir keresinde kendi tasarımımı olduğu gibi klonlamışlardı deli olmuştum. :(
Aslında bir çok webmaster arkadaşımız bu yöntemleri az çok bilir, amacım hepsini derli toplu bir başlık altında toplayıp, yeni webmaster arkadaşlara faydalı bir kaynak oluşturabilmekti.

Otomatik robotların içeriği kopyalamasıyla ilgili bir madde daha ekledim. 9. maddeyi incelemenizi öneririm.
 

orhanorak

Pratik Üye
Katılım
21 Şub 2008
Mesajlar
16
Beğeniler
0
#6
paylaşım için sağolasın nokie.. Bugünlerde bilgi hırsızları fazlalaştı. İnsanlar web işine girdikçe bu azalmayacak günden güne artacak. örneğin uğrşıp css dosyanı ayarlıyorsun bir bakmışsın aynı dosya başka bir sitede. Emek verip makale yazıyorsun kişi kendi makalesiymiş gibi sitesine ekliyor. bu uyraıları ve uygulamaları dikkate almakta fayda var. Özgün içeriği olan her sitenin bu önlemleri alması gereklidir diye düşünüğyorum.Bu bir sorumluluktur sadece kendisine değil üyelerine karşıda sorumluluktur.Çünkü onlarında bilgi ve emekleri çarpılmaktadır..

tekrar ellerine sağlık bu derlemeyi paylaşmamda sakınca yoktur sanırım. tabi senin ve iyinetin ismiyle..
 

nokie

Müptela Üye
Katılım
23 Mar 2005
Mesajlar
1,597
Beğeniler
8
Yaş
35
Konum
İzmir
#7
Merhaba, tabiki paylaşabilirsiniz, duyarlılığınız için teşekkür ederim.
 

Darkart

Onursal
Onursal Üye
Katılım
1 Tem 2005
Mesajlar
7,040
Beğeniler
54
Yaş
42
#8
tabiki bir çoğumuz biliyor belki ama bilmeyende az sayıda değil, güzel çalışma olmuş ;)
 
Katılım
27 Ara 2007
Mesajlar
2,110
Beğeniler
1
Yaş
29
Konum
cHeteM
#9
ellerine sağlık gerçekten güzel bir çalışma. aklıma şu geldi internet explorerdan file menüsünden save as yapılabiliyor bunu nasıl engelleriz.
 

nokie

Müptela Üye
Katılım
23 Mar 2005
Mesajlar
1,597
Beğeniler
8
Yaş
35
Konum
İzmir
#10
ellerine sağlık gerçekten güzel bir çalışma. aklıma şu geldi internet explorerdan file menüsünden save as yapılabiliyor bunu nasıl engelleriz.
faydalı olduğuna sevindim, sanırım sizin sorununuz tasarım çalınmasıyla ilgili.. 1. ve 2. adımları uygularsanız size çözüm olacaktır.
 

xgitarx

Müptela Üye
Katılım
25 May 2010
Mesajlar
1,354
Beğeniler
23
#11
6. ve 7. maddeleri yaptığımızda google analytics site istatistiklerini çekemiyor diye biliyorum doğru mu acaba?
 

Gamerozzie

Profesyonel Üye
Katılım
21 Haz 2011
Mesajlar
259
Beğeniler
1
Konum
SMYRNA
#14
Katılıyorum, çok faydalı olmuş yalnız şunu merak ettim
RewriteEngine on
RewriteCond %{HTTP_REFERER} !^http(s)?://(www\.)?alanadı.com [NC]
RewriteRule \.css$ - [NC,F,L]
Kodu N-Stealth gibi tarayarak çalan programları engelliyormu ?
 

Bu konuyu okuyanlar (Üyeler: 1, Misafirler: 0)

Üst